NEWS: Xbox Hits Reset

In an internal letter sent to Xbox employees worldwide, Asha (CEO of Xbox) announced the largest restructuring in Xbox's history, outlining the company's plan to "reset Xbox" and return the business to long-term growth.

The restructuring includes approximately 3,200 positions being eliminated during FY27, including 1,600 layoffs immediately. Xbox is also reshaping its studio portfolio, with Compulsion Games and Double Fine Productions becoming independent again, while Ninja Theory and Undead Labs will transition to new ownership. Meanwhile, Arkane Studios is exploring strategic options in France.

In the letter, Asha said Xbox's current business model is unsustainable, citing profit margins 3–10 times lower than competitors, slower-than-expected growth from initiatives like Game Pass and multiplatform publishing, and what it describes as the gaming industry's worst hardware downturn. Despite major investments, Xbox says its core business has weakened.

To address these issues, Xbox plans to:

Refocus its game portfolio and support independent developers rather than owning more studios.
Simplify its organization by reducing management layers from as many as 14 down to a maximum of 5 (and ideally 3).
Cut vendor spending by 50%, streamline internal tools, and improve accountability.
Place Mojang Studios and King under direct executive oversight due to their scale and importance.
Create a new Chief Operating Officer role, promoting Helen Chiang to oversee content, hardware, platform, and services.
Acknowledge the retirement of Dave McCarthy after 17 years with the company.

Xbox emphasized that no publicly announced first-party games have been canceled as part of the restructuring and stated that it intends to continue investing heavily while becoming a leaner, more focused organization. Leadership says the goal is to return Xbox to growth in 2027 and position it for long-term success.

NEWS: Xbox Games Showcase 2026 and Gears of War: E-Day Direct Set for June 7 2026

On Sunday, June 7, the annual double feature returns, providing a look at what’s next from Xbox and its global partners. The Xbox Games Showcase 2026 begins at 10 a.m. Pacific / 1 p.m. Eastern / 6 p.m. UK, followed immediately by the Gears of War: E-Day Direct, presented by The Coalition, the studio behind the next mainline entry in one of Xbox’s most iconic franchises.

This year marks the 25th anniversary of Xbox, and the showcase is expected to be a major celebration featuring world premieres, new gameplay reveals, updates, and more across a wide range of upcoming projects.


The Xbox Games Showcase will begin at the following times:

PDT: June 7, 10 a.m.
EDT: June 7, 1 p.m.
BST: June 7, 6 p.m.
CEST: June 7, 7 p.m.
JST: June 8, 2 a.m.
AEST: June 8, 3 a.m.

The Gears of War: E-Day Direct will begin immediately after the Xbox Games Showcase concludes.

The showcase and direct will be streamed live on official Xbox channels.

NEWS: More In-Game Benefits for Free-to-Play Games with Game Pass

Starting this week, Game Pass Ultimate and PC Game Pass members will receive even more value with added in-game benefits for free-to-play games. These benefits will include items like cosmetics, characters, in-game currency, and more, for games such as Heroes of the Storm, Naraka: Bladepoint, and The Finals. Additionally, starting in April 2025, more in-game benefits will be available for games like Call of Duty: Warzone and Enlisted. With seasonal content drops, there will always be new rewards to look forward to.





These new perks expand on existing in-game benefits, including unlocking the full champion roster in League of Legends, six skins in Overwatch 2, all agents in Valorant, and more. Whether it’s for customization, personalization, or progression, Game Pass members will continue to get even more out of their gaming experience.

To access these in-game benefits, Game Pass Ultimate and PC Game Pass members simply need to log in with their Xbox profile or link it to the game’s account. Then, by launching the game on Xbox on PC or console, their additional perks will be available in-game. For Game Pass Ultimate members, these benefits can also be used across cloud, console, and PC.

New In-Game Benefits Available Now:

Heroes of the Storm (PC) – Link your Battle.net account
Unlock 30 Heroes from across Blizzard’s universes.

Naraka: Bladepoint (Cloud, Console, and PC) – Log in with your Xbox profile
Unlock all heroes, exclusive Xbox headgear, and the Phoenix Princess Pack (Justina Gu).

Smite 2 (Console and PC) – Link your account
Unlock the exclusive High Velocity Hecate Skin, five gods (Ares, Anhur, Hecate, Hercules, and Nemesis), the OP Title, and GG Emote with the Smite 2 Welcome Pack.

The Finals (Xbox Series X|S and PC) – Link your Embark ID
Unlock the Stryker Grid Set, featuring an outfit, three weapon skins, a charm, and a 25% Match XP boost, plus 500 Multibucks.

FREEBIES: Xbox Live Games With Gold for May 2022

For the month of May 2022, Xbox Live Gold and Xbox Game Pass Ultimate members will receive four FREE games – two on Xbox Series X, Series S and Xbox One, and  two on Xbox 360 – as part of the Games with Gold program. You can play all four of the titles on your Xbox One or Xbox Series X|S with Backward Compatibility.

*Titles are available as free downloads for qualifying Xbox Live Gold and Game Pass Ultimate members in all markets where Xbox Live is available. Some regions may offer different titles depending on market availability.
